Chào cả nhà,
WordPress có tính năng Multisite (Đa trang) rất mạnh, cho phép tạo hàng trăm web con trên 1 bộ source code duy nhất. Nghe thì tiện (update 1 lần được cả trăm site), nhưng “hiểm họa” cũng không ít.
KHI NÀO NÊN DÙNG?
-
Chuỗi cửa hàng/Chi nhánh: Ví dụ bạn có hanoi.domain.com, saigon.domain.com… Giao diện giống hệt nhau, chỉ khác nội dung liên hệ/sản phẩm.
-
Web đa ngôn ngữ (Multilingual): Nếu không thích dùng WPML hay Polylang vì nặng, thì tách mỗi ngôn ngữ 1 sub-site là giải pháp cực sạch sẽ.
-
Hệ thống site vệ tinh PBN: Cùng chủ sở hữu, cần quản lý tập trung user và theme.
KHI NÀO TUYỆT ĐỐI KHÔNG NÊN?
-
Các web tính năng khác nhau: Site A bán hàng, Site B tin tức, Site C forum… Gom vào Multisite là chết dở vì xung đột plugin tùm lum.
-
Web của khách hàng khác nhau: Đừng dại dột host chung web khách A và khách B vào 1 cụm Multisite.
-
Bảo mật: Đây là điểm yếu chí mạng. Nếu Hacker khai thác được lỗ hổng ở site chính hoặc 1 site con, toàn bộ hệ thống các site còn lại sẽ đi bụi hết. Một con VPS bị hack thì cả dây chuyền sập.
Mình từng phải tách một cụm Multisite ra thành từng site lẻ vì database phình to quá nhanh, backup/restore cực khổ vô cùng. Anh em nào có ý định dùng thì cân nhắc kỹ nhé!
